British Prime Minister Boris Johnson announced on Twitter yesterday that he was presiding over the first ever digital cabinet, while isolating himself in Downing Street after revealing he was suffering from "mild symptoms" of Coronavirus.
Johnson tweeted a screenshot of his desktop, showing that there were 35 participants in the Zoom meeting.
But the screenshot also revealed some details that it probably wasn't wise to share.
Because a careful examination of the screenshot reveals the meeting ID of the Zoom call.
Hopefully the password wasn't 1234.
